The chairman of Lagos State Parks and Garages management committee, Musiliu Akinsanya aka MC Oluomo has claimed people didn’t die at Lekki Tollgate during the #EndSARS protesters of 2020.

Oluomo spoke on Sunday during the rally he organised in Lagos to support his candidate, Bola Tinubu, and the Lagos State Governor, Babajide Sanwo-Olu.

Oluomo said, “Where are the bodies and where are they buried? Do they have relatives in Nigeria? Has Nigeria bribed the mothers of the deceased protesters? Why are their siblings not searching for them, even on social media? Or is Asiwaju Bola Ahmed Tinubu a Chief of Army Staff or President who will order the killing of protesters at the (Lekki) Tollgate?”

“They’re lying to us, they want to undermine the Yorubas, everyone should come out. It is a political game. It was Atiku and Obi that conspired to do all those things then.”

In October 2020, thousands of youths trooped out to the streets in Nigeria and the diaspora, protesting extra-judicial killing by the police, particularly by the defunct Special Anti-Robbery Squad.

Following the shooting at Lekki Tollgate on October 20, 2020, a Judicial Panel was set up by the state government to investigate petitions on police brutality in the state.

The panel submitted two reports — one on police brutality cases and another on the Lekki incident investigation.

The panel listed 10 fatalities arising from the shooting by the Nigerian Military at the Lekki tollgate on October 20, 2020. It also recommended the redeployment and prosecution of the Divisional Police Officer of Maroko Police Station, for the arbitrary shooting and killing of protesters.

Meanwhile, the report had since being a subject of controversy, especially with the Federal Government rejecting the panel report for inconsistencies.

Ebonyi State Governor Francis Nwifuru has hit back at socialite and businessman Paschal Okechukwu, better known as Cubana Chief Priest, after the latter criticised his administration.

The governor dismissed the businessman’s comments while speaking at an event in Abakaliki, saying he had no interest in engaging with him.

I don’t have time for Cubana Chief Priest. He’s a mere attention-seeker and an individual of no consequence” Nwifuru said.

He added, “However, if I remember him, I feel sorry for him.”

The exchange followed comments by Cubana Chief Priest questioning the governor’s performance in office. He reportedly challenged Nwifuru to explain how an administration could spend about three years in office without having major projects commissioned by the President or other state governors.

The remarks had earlier attracted criticism from Chinedu Ogah, the member representing Ikwo/Ezza South Federal Constituency in the House of Representatives.

Ogah condemned Cubana Chief Priest’s comments, defending the governor’s administration.

Nwifuru’s response now adds another layer to the controversy, although the governor did not provide a detailed response to the specific claims made about projects commissioned under his administration.

The disagreement has consequently shifted attention to the broader question of the Ebonyi government’s record on infrastructure and development projects since Nwifuru assumed office.

An early-morning building collapse in Enugu has left one person dead and four others injured after a four-storey structure under construction suddenly gave way in the Independence Layout area of the state.

 

The incident occurred around 6 a.m. on Sunday on Ogbalu Street, where workers were reportedly sleeping inside the construction site when the building collapsed.

Four workers were pulled from the debris alive and taken to the Enugu State Teaching Hospital for medical treatment.

Authorities said six people had been sleeping at the site before the incident, but one of them had reportedly stepped out shortly before the structure came down. The body of another victim was recovered from the rubble.

 

The rescue operation has drawn the involvement of several emergency and security agencies, including the National Emergency Management Agency, Nigerian Red Cross Society, State Emergency Management Agency, Enugu State Capital Territory Development Authority and the Police.

Officials are still working at the scene to determine whether anyone else may be trapped beneath the debris.

The cause of the collapse remains unknown as of the time of reporting.

The incident has also renewed questions about compliance with construction standards, site safety and the effectiveness of regulatory monitoring in Enugu.

Osun State Governor Ademola Adeleke has directed security agencies to arrest anyone found to have been involved in the reported killing of his associate, Olamilekan Ajagungbade, popularly known as Emir Ajagungbade.

Ajagungbade was reportedly shot dead in Ile-Ife on Sunday amid a dispute connected to the leadership of a motor park.

Reacting to the incident, Adeleke ordered Commissioner of Police Ibrahim Zungura to take immediate action against those responsible. The directive was disclosed by the governor’s spokesperson, Olawale Rasheed.

The governor also ordered rival groups involved in the park dispute to leave the motor parks while security agencies work to restore calm.

There will be no sacred cows as all culprits will be brought to book” Adeleke said, while urging residents to remain calm.

As part of his response, the governor announced plans to bring back the Park Management System across the state, saying an Executive Order would soon be issued to provide the legal backing for the arrangement.

The renewed system is expected to regulate the operation of motor parks and garages and address disputes over their management.

Ajagungbade was described in the report as a close associate of the governor and a member of the Accord Party.

The circumstances surrounding the shooting and the identities of those responsible had not been fully disclosed at the time of reporting.
